Output 659434ae3feef4eb16fc54ca0f94dba52d1d734ac0559149645d960a5007d928:1

value
7407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1077a20093e1d476128b061da141030430daae5b OP_EQUAL
address
33C63r6CLhFy64a454uYAznh6oqhkS8UK6
transaction
659434ae3feef4eb16fc54ca0f94dba52d1d734ac0559149645d960a5007d928
spent
true